LE CLOS DES COMBALS
Information
- Description
- Founded in 2017 by Marie-Noëlle Tournes, Le Clos des Combals is located in Saint-Jean-de-Fos, on the terroirs of the Terrasses du Larzac AOP and Saint-Guilhem-le-Désert IGP.
L’Initiée, L’Appliquée, L’Enracinée, L’Obstinée, L’Héritée… Our vintages embody the values of hard work, perseverance, and the promotion of the terroir. Combined with a feminine touch, they are imbued with the initiatory journey of their winemaker and the transmission of the vineyard from woman to woman.
The 10 hectares of vines are cultivated using organic farming methods, harvested by hand, then vinified and aged separately.
Le Clos des Combals practices mixed cultivation of vines and olive trees. Their complementary and mutually beneficial cycles provide natural fertilizer, shade, and biodiversity.
With 1.5 hectares of olive groves and olive trees scattered throughout our vineyard plots, or nearly 400 trees, the estate produces olives of the traditional Lucques, Picholine, Verdale de l’Hérault and Amellau varieties.
